Upgrading WordPress to the latest version is surprisingly easy following these instructions.

The easiest way as it turned out is actually to update often. While there is no need to follow every single minor releases, it is nevertheless a good idea not to skip too many releases in a row.

I found out this when I upgraded to 2.6.2 from an early 2.2 version. Since there has been many release in between, the database has changed quite a bit and after the upgrade I found out that the categories were messed up. Luckily it was not too time consuming to update the post categories back using SQL scripts. But after that upgrading to 2.6.3 and then to 2.6.5 had been a breeze.
